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90007915632 153 145 78370 4922
648048938 5544163 90538524668
648048938 5544163 90538524668
4130 7689 872
All about undefined
Interested in learning more?
648048938 5544163 90538524668
4130 7689 872
See more
72780644 31
7045 5396093185 7096
See more
7260 1296
61 92 94
See more